.box{margin-bottom:10px;}
.box-head{color:#f6f6f6;font-size:20px;line-height:20px;letter-spacing:-1px;padding:16px 0 5px 19px;}
.box-head a{color:#f6f6f6;text-decoration:none;}.box-body ul{margin:0;padding:0;list-style:none;}.box-body ul li a{color:#a6a4a4;font-size:12px;line-height:31px;text-decoration:none;background:url(../images/cat-bg.gif) repeat-x left top;display:block;border-left:1px solid #e7e7e7;border-right:1px solid #e7e7e7;padding:3px 0 0 19px;}
.box-body ul li a:hover{color:#000;font-weight:bold;}
.box-body ul li.category-products{padding:0;margin-left:-15px;}
.box-body ul li.category-products a{padding-left:30px;}
.box-body ul li a .category-subs-parent-selected,.box-body ul li a .category-subs-selected{color:#000;font-weight:bold;}
.box-body ol{margin:0;padding:0;list-style:decimal inside;border-bottom:1px solid #e7e7e7}
.box-body ol li{background:url(../images/cat-bg.gif) repeat-x left top #f6f6f6;font-size:12px;line-height:31px;border-left:1px solid #e7e7e7;border-right:1px solid #e7e7e7;padding:2px 0 0 15px;color:#a6a4a4;}
.box-body ol li a{color:#a6a4a4;text-decoration:none;padding-left:2px;}
.box-body ol li a:hover{color:#000;}
#categories{border-bottom:1px solid #e7e7e7;margin-bottom:6px;}
#categories .box-head{background:url(../images/title-bg.jpg) repeat-x left top;padding-bottom:19px;}
#moreinformation{border-bottom:1px solid #e7e7e7;background:url(../images/title-bg.jpg) repeat-x left top;padding-bottom:19px;}
#moreinformation .box-head{background:url(../images/title-4bg.jpg) repeat-x left top;padding-bottom:19px;}
#moreinformation .box-body{border:none!important;padding:0!important;}
#information{border-bottom:1px solid #e7e7e7;}
#information .box-head{background:url(../images/title-bg.jpg) repeat-x left top;padding-bottom:19px;}
#bestsellers{margin-bottom:0;}
#bestsellers .box-head{background:url(../images/title-4bg.jpg) repeat-x left top;padding-bottom:19px;}
#bestsellers .box-body{padding:0!important;border:none!important;}
#ezpages{border-bottom:1px solid #e7e7e7;}
#ezpages .box-head{background:url(../images/title-4bg.jpg) repeat-x left top;padding-bottom:19px;}#orderhistory .box-head{background:url(../images/title-4bg.jpg) repeat-x left top;padding-bottom:19px;}
#orderhistory .box-body{padding-top:7px;border:1px solid #e7e7e7;background:url(../images/product-col-bg.jpg) no-repeat left top;}
#orderhistory  li{overflow:hidden;padding-bottom:2px;padding-left:5px;}
#orderhistory  li a{padding:0;margin:0;background:none;border:none;padding-bottom:5px;}
#orderhistory  li a img{margin-left:0!important;float:left;margin-right:10px!important;margin-top:4px!important;}
#orderhistory  li a.no-bg{width:185px;display:block;line-height:19px;float:left;}
#orderhistory  li a:hover{font-weight:normal;}
#orderhistory .box-body img{background:#FFFFFF;padding:2px;border:1px solid #AAAAAA;vertical-align:middle;margin:2px 0px 2px 15px;}
#orderhistory .no-bg{background:none;padding:0;}
#orderhistory a{display:inline;}#bannerbox .box-head{display:none;}#bannerbox2 .box-head{display:none;}#bannerboxall .box-head{display:none;}
#featured a img,#whatsnew a img,#specials a img,#reviews a img,#manufacturerinfo img,#productnotifications img{margin:0 0 8px;}
#reviews img{margin:5px 0 0;}#featured .box-head{background:url(../images/title-bg3.jpg) repeat-x left top;padding-bottom:19px;margin-bottom:8px;}
#featured .box-body{border:1px solid #e7e7e7;background:url(../images/product-col-bg.jpg) no-repeat left top;padding:15px 0 19px 0;}
#featured .box-body a img{margin-left:39px}
#featured .box-body .name{color:#372e26;font-size:12px;line-height:17px;font-weight:normal;margin:0 19px;display:block;border-bottom:1px solid #eeeeee;padding-bottom:6px;padding-top:6px;}
#featured .box-body .price{padding-left:19px;padding-top:6px;}
#featured .box-body .buttons{padding-left:19px;padding-top:8px;}
#featured .box-body .buttons a img{margin:0;}
#featured .box-body .normalprice{text-decoration:line-through;color:#545353;font-size:20px;line-height:20px;}
#featured .box-body .productSpecialPrice,.productSalePrice,.productSpecialPriceSale{color:#545353;font-size:20px;line-height:20px;}#whatsnew .box-head{background:url(../images/title-bg3.jpg) repeat-x left top;padding-bottom:19px;margin-bottom:8px;}
#whatsnew .box-body{border:1px solid #e7e7e7;background:url(../images/product-col-bg.jpg) no-repeat left top;padding:15px 0 19px 0;}
#whatsnew .box-body a img{margin-left:39px}
#whatsnew .box-body .name{color:#372e26;font-size:12px;line-height:17px;font-weight:normal;margin:0 19px;display:block;border-bottom:1px solid #eeeeee;padding-bottom:6px;padding-top:6px;}
#whatsnew .box-body .price{padding-left:19px;padding-top:6px;}
#whatsnew .box-body .buttons{padding-left:19px;padding-top:8px;}
#whatsnew .box-body .buttons a img{margin:0;}
#whatsnew .box-body .normalprice{text-decoration:line-through;color:#545353;font-size:20px;line-height:20px;}
#whatsnew .box-body .productSpecialPrice,.productSalePrice,.productSpecialPriceSale{color:#545353;font-size:20px;line-height:20px;}#specials .box-head{background:url(../images/title-bg3.jpg) repeat-x left top;padding-bottom:19px;margin-bottom:8px;}
#specials .box-body{border:1px solid #e7e7e7;background:url(../images/product-col-bg.jpg) no-repeat left top;padding:15px 0 19px 0;}
#specials .box-body a img{margin-left:39px}
#specials .box-body .name{color:#372e26;font-size:12px;line-height:17px;font-weight:normal;margin:0 19px;display:block;border-bottom:1px solid #eeeeee;padding-bottom:6px;padding-top:6px;}
#specials .box-body .price{padding-left:19px;padding-top:6px;}
#specials .box-body .buttons{padding-left:19px;padding-top:8px;}
#specials .box-body .buttons a img{margin:0;padding-right:2px;}
#specials .box-body .normalprice{text-decoration:line-through;color:#545353;font-size:20px;line-height:20px;}
#specials .box-body .productSpecialPrice,.productSalePrice,.productSpecialPriceSale{color:#545353;font-size:20px;line-height:20px;}#reviews .box-head{background:url(../images/title-bg3.jpg) repeat-x left top;padding-bottom:19px;margin-bottom:8px;}
#reviews .box-body{border:1px solid #e7e7e7;background:url(../images/product-col-bg.jpg) no-repeat left top;padding:15px 0 19px 0;}#reviews .box-body .name{color:#372e26;font-size:12px;line-height:17px;font-weight:normal;margin:0 19px;display:block;border-bottom:1px solid #eeeeee;padding-bottom:6px;padding-top:6px;}
#reviews .box-body .price{padding-left:19px;padding-top:6px;}
#reviews .box-body .buttons{padding-left:19px;padding-top:8px;}
#reviews .box-body .buttons a img{margin:0;}
#reviews .box-body .normalprice{text-decoration:line-through;color:#545353;font-size:20px;line-height:20px;}
#reviews .box-body .productSpecialPrice,.productSalePrice,.productSpecialPriceSale{color:#545353;font-size:20px;line-height:20px;}
#reviews .box-body{text-align:center;}#productnotifications .box-head{background:url(../images/title-bg3.jpg) repeat-x left top;padding-bottom:19px;margin-bottom:8px;}
#productnotifications .box-body{border:1px solid #e7e7e7;background:url(../images/product-col-bg.jpg) no-repeat left top;padding:15px 10px 19px 10px;}
#productnotifications .box-body{text-align:center;}
#search{background:url(../images/box1-bg.jpg) no-repeat left top;margin-bottom:0;}
#search .box-body{padding-bottom:20px;overflow:hidden;width:100%;}
#search input{border:solid 0px;padding:0;background:none;vertical-align:middle;float:left;}
#search .input1{border:solid 1px #fff;background:#fff;margin-left:20px;padding:4px 5px 4px 5px;width:147px;}
#manufacturers{background:url(../images/box2-bg.jpg) no-repeat left top;padding-bottom:20px;margin-bottom:17px;}
#manufacturers select{width:187px!important;color:#9a8983;}
#manufacturers .box-body{text-align:center;}#currencies{background:url(../images/box1-bg.jpg) no-repeat left top;}
#currencies .box-body{padding-bottom:20px;overflow:hidden;width:100%;}
#currencies .box-body{text-align:center;}
#currencies select{width:90%;}#tellafriend{background:#2f140b;}
#tellafriend .box-body{padding-bottom:20px;overflow:hidden;width:100%;text-align:center;color:#fff;}
#tellafriend .no-border input{border:solid 0px;padding:0;}#recordcompanies .box-body{text-align:center;}#musicgenres .box-body{text-align:center;}
#languages{background:url(../images/box1-bg.jpg) no-repeat left top;}
#languages .box-body{padding-bottom:20px;overflow:hidden;width:100%;}
#languages .box-body{text-align:center;}
#whosonline{background:url(../images/box1-bg.jpg) no-repeat left top;}
#whosonline .box-body{padding-bottom:20px;overflow:hidden;width:100%;color:#fff;}
#whosonline .box-body{text-align:center;}#shoppingcart .box-head{background:url(../images/title-bg3.jpg) repeat-x left top;padding-bottom:19px;margin-bottom:8px;}
#shoppingcart .box-body{padding-bottom:20px;overflow:hidden;width:100%;border:1px solid #e7e7e7;background:url(../images/product-col-bg.jpg) no-repeat left top;padding:5px 0;}
#shoppingcart  li{overflow:hidden;padding:5px 0;margin:0 5px;border-bottom:1px solid #e7e7e7;}
#shoppingcart .price{padding-right:15px;}
#shoppingcart  li a{background:none;border:none;padding:0;margin:0;float:left;display:inline-block;overflow:hidden;width:180px;line-height:15px;cursor:pointer;}
#shoppingcart li span{float:left!important;display:block;overflow:hidden;position:relative;top:-1px;margin-right:5px;}
#shoppingcart  li a:hover{font-weight:normal;}
#shoppingcart  li a span{float:none;top:0;}#shoppingcart #cartBoxEmpty{text-align:center;}
